>> Currently we set _WIN32_WINNT at various places in the codebase; this is 
>> used to target a minimum Windows version we want to support. See also for 
>> more detailled information :
>> https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/win32/winprog/using-the-windows-headers?redirectedfrom=MSDN#setting-winver-or-_win32_winnt
>> Macros for Conditional Declarations
>> "Certain functions that depend on a particular version of Windows are 
>> declared using conditional code. This enables you to use the compiler to 
>> detect whether your application uses functions that are not supported on its 
>> target version(s) of Windows."
>> 
>> However currently we have quite a lot of differing settings of _WIN32_WINNT 
>> in the codebase ; setting _WIN32_WINNT to 0x0601 (Windows 7) where possible 
>> would make sense because we have this setting already at   java_props_md.c  
>> (so targeting older Windows versions at other places is most likely not 
>> useful).
